如何序列化邮件消息
.NET 中有两个 MailMessage 类。第一个在 System.Web.Mail 命名空间中,在 .NET 2.0 及更高版本中已过时,第二个在 System.Net.Mail 中可用。我不关心过时的,所以我只展示如何序列化 System.Net.Mail.MailMessage 类的实例。
要序列化 MailMessage 对象的属性,您可以创建一个新类并为其创建一个 MailMessage 类型的属性,将您的 MailMessage 嵌入到该类中。在这个新类中,您可以实现 IXmlSerializable 接口来手动序列化其 MailMessage。
序列化
序列化方面的工作就像实现 WriteXml 方法一样简单。下面的代码是我为此编写的。
public void WriteXml(XmlWriter writer)
{
if (this != null)
{
writer.WriteStartElement("MailMessage");
writer.WriteAttributeString("Priority", Convert.ToInt16(this.Priority).ToString());
writer.WriteAttributeString("IsBodyHtml", this.IsBodyHtml.ToString());
// From
writer.WriteStartElement("From");
if (!string.IsNullOrEmpty(this.From.DisplayName))
writer.WriteAttributeString("DisplayName", this.From.DisplayName);
writer.WriteRaw(this.From.Address);
writer.WriteEndElement();
// To
writer.WriteStartElement("To");
writer.WriteStartElement("Addresses");
foreach (MailAddress address in this.To)
{
writer.WriteStartElement("Address");
if (!string.IsNullOrEmpty(address.DisplayName))
writer.WriteAttributeString("DisplayName", address.DisplayName);
writer.WriteRaw(address.Address);
writer.WriteEndElement();
}
writer.WriteEndElement();
writer.WriteEndElement();
// CC
if (this.CC.Count > 0)
{
writer.WriteStartElement("CC");
writer.WriteStartElement("Addresses");
foreach (MailAddress address in this.CC)
{
writer.WriteStartElement("Address");
if (!string.IsNullOrEmpty(address.DisplayName))
writer.WriteAttributeString("DisplayName", address.DisplayName);
writer.WriteRaw(address.Address);
writer.WriteEndElement();
}
writer.WriteEndElement();
writer.WriteEndElement();
}
// Bcc
if (this.Bcc.Count > 0)
{
writer.WriteStartElement("Bcc");
writer.WriteStartElement("Addresses");
foreach (MailAddress address in this.Bcc)
{
writer.WriteStartElement("Address");
if (!string.IsNullOrEmpty(address.DisplayName))
writer.WriteAttributeString("DisplayName", address.DisplayName);
writer.WriteRaw(address.Address);
writer.WriteEndElement();
}
writer.WriteEndElement();
writer.WriteEndElement();
}
// Subject
writer.WriteStartElement("Subject");
writer.WriteRaw(this.Subject);
writer.WriteEndElement();
// Body
writer.WriteStartElement("Body");
writer.WriteCData(Body);
writer.WriteEndElement();
writer.WriteEndElement();
}
}
按照相同的方法,您可以序列化其他属性,如附件。下周我将发布新版本的 Gopi,其中包含序列化所有内容的更新代码,因此您可以稍等片刻获得代码。
反序列化
public void ReadXml(XmlReader reader)
{
XmlDocument xml = new XmlDocument();
xml.Load(reader);
// Properties
XmlNode rootNode = GetConfigSection(xml, "SerializableMailMessage/MailMessage");
this.IsBodyHtml = Convert.ToBoolean(rootNode.Attributes["IsBodyHtml"].Value);
this.Priority = (MailPriority)Convert.ToInt16(rootNode.Attributes["Priority"].Value);
// From
XmlNode fromNode = GetConfigSection(xml, "SerializableMailMessage/MailMessage/From");
string fromDisplayName = string.Empty;
if (fromNode.Attributes["DisplayName"] != null)
fromDisplayName = fromNode.Attributes["DisplayName"].Value;
MailAddress fromAddress = new MailAddress(fromNode.InnerText, fromDisplayName);
this.From = fromAddress;
// To
XmlNode toNode = GetConfigSection(xml, "SerializableMailMessage/MailMessage/To/Addresses");
foreach (XmlNode node in toNode.ChildNodes)
{
string toDisplayName = string.Empty;
if (node.Attributes["DisplayName"] != null)
toDisplayName = node.Attributes["DisplayName"].Value;
MailAddress toAddress = new MailAddress(node.InnerText, toDisplayName);
this.To.Add(toAddress);
}
// CC
XmlNode ccNode = GetConfigSection(xml, "SerializableMailMessage/MailMessage/CC/Addresses");
foreach (XmlNode node in ccNode.ChildNodes)
{
string ccDisplayName = string.Empty;
if (node.Attributes["DisplayName"] != null)
ccDisplayName = node.Attributes["DisplayName"].Value;
MailAddress ccAddress = new MailAddress(node.InnerText, ccDisplayName);
this.CC.Add(ccAddress);
}
// Bcc
XmlNode bccNode = GetConfigSection(xml, "SerializableMailMessage/MailMessage/Bcc/Addresses");
foreach (XmlNode node in bccNode.ChildNodes)
{
string bccDisplayName = string.Empty;
if (node.Attributes["DisplayName"] != null)
bccDisplayName = node.Attributes["DisplayName"].Value;
MailAddress bccAddress = new MailAddress(node.InnerText, bccDisplayName);
this.Bcc.Add(bccAddress);
}
// Subject
XmlNode subjectNode = GetConfigSection(xml, "SerializableMailMessage/MailMessage/Subject");
this.Subject = subjectNode.InnerText;
// Body
XmlNode bodyNode = GetConfigSection(xml, "SerializableMailMessage/MailMessage/Body");
this.Body = bodyNode.InnerText;
}
以上代码使用辅助方法来获取不同部分的 XmlNode。
public XmlNode GetConfigSection(XmlDocument xml, string nodePath)
{
return xml.SelectSingleNode(nodePath);
}
此代码是不言自明的,不需要任何注释,但请注意,您需要为类名更新 XPath 表达式。当然,我可以使用反射来使这段代码更通用,但有时我是个坏人!
